Dear Roby, YoWindow is taking the current weather for Amatrice from Pescara.
Pescara is the closest reliable METAR station to Amatrice.
http://en.allmetsat.com/metar-taf/europe.php?icao=LIBP
Unfortunately, it is very far.
This is why the weather is always wrong.

Hello, Roby, we do not own weather stations.
The current weather is provided by NWS
There are at least two reasons to add new locations, even small ones to YoWindow.

1. The most accurate weather forecast for the given coordinates.
2. Astronomical events are computed precisely for the place (sunset, sun and moon)
